In Japan, there are two types of people who get away with breaking “the rules” of society. Gaijin, of course—they call it “gaijin power”, they just assume westerners don’t know any better. The second type is elderly women. The logic is that they’ve lived their lives, raised their children, and they’ve earned the right to color outside of the lines now and then.![]()
